How To Apply For Acting In Tv Serials 2021

Are you ready to shine on the small screen? Applying for acting roles in TV serials can be an exciting and rewarding experience. With the rise of digital platforms, there are now more opportunities than ever to showcase your talent and become a household name.
The first step is to update your portfolio, which should include a professional headshot, a resume, and a demonstration reel showcasing your acting abilities. Make sure your online presence is also up-to-date, including your social media profiles and any personal websites or blogs. This will help you to be easily discoverable by casting directors and agents.
Getting Started
To begin your journey, research casting calls and auditions for TV serials that match your skills and interests. You can find these listings on websites such as
Backstageor
Mandy.com, which cater to the entertainment industry. Look for roles that fit your type, whether it's drama, comedy, or something else.

Once you've found a casting call that you're interested in, make sure to read the requirements carefully and follow the submission guidelines. This may include sending in a headshot and resume, or recording a self-tape audition and uploading it to the specified platform. Be sure to proofread your materials carefully to avoid any mistakes.
Casting directors often receive hundreds of submissions for each role, so it's essential to stand out from the crowd. One way to do this is to showcase your unique personality and bring a fresh perspective to the character. Don't be afraid to take risks and try new things – it's often the most memorable auditions that land the role.

The Audition Process
When you land an audition, be sure to prepare thoroughly by rehearsing your lines and researching the character and the show. Arrive early and dressed to impress, and be ready to introduce yourself confidently and showcase your talents. Remember that the casting director wants you to succeed, so try to relax and have fun with the process.
After the audition, follow up with a thank-you note or email to express your gratitude for the opportunity and reiterate your interest in the role. This can help to keep you top of mind for the casting director and increase your chances of landing the part. And if you don't get the role, don't be discouraged – every audition is a learning experience and an opportunity to grow as an actor.
